Yes, you can absolutely scan film with a Canon Rebel XS (also known as the EOS 1000D). While not designed specifically for film scanning, this entry-level DSLR, coupled with the right accessories and techniques, can produce surprisingly high-quality results, making it a viable alternative to dedicated film scanners for many hobbyists and photographers.

The Canon Rebel XS as a Film Scanner: What You Need
While the Canon Rebel XS won’t magically transform into a dedicated scanner, it possesses the core ingredients: a good sensor and the ability to be connected to a computer for tethered shooting. Here’s what you’ll need to get started:
- Canon Rebel XS (EOS 1000D) Camera Body: Obviously, the foundation of your setup. Ensure it’s in good working condition and has a clean sensor.
- Macro Lens: The most crucial element. A true macro lens allows you to focus extremely close to your film, capturing the fine details. Look for a focal length between 50mm and 100mm. Popular options include Canon’s EF 50mm f/2.5 Compact Macro, EF 100mm f/2.8 Macro USM, or third-party options from Sigma, Tamron, or Laowa.
- Light Source: A consistent and diffused light source is essential for even illumination. LED light panels designed for product photography are excellent choices. Alternatively, a daylight-balanced light box or even a tablet displaying a white screen can work. Avoid using direct sunlight, as it’s inconsistent and can introduce unwanted color casts.
- Film Holder: This holds your negatives or slides flat and securely in front of the light source. Dedicated film holders can be purchased, or you can create a DIY version using cardboard, glass, or acrylic. The key is to ensure the film remains perfectly flat during the scanning process.
- Copy Stand or Tripod: A sturdy copy stand or tripod allows for precise positioning of the camera above the film holder. This ensures consistent framing and sharpness across all your scans.
- Tethering Software (Optional): Software like Canon EOS Utility (often bundled with the camera) or other third-party options allows you to control your camera from your computer, view the images on a larger screen, and streamline the capture process.
- Scanning & Editing Software: After capturing the images, you’ll need software to invert negatives (if applicable), crop, adjust colors, and remove dust and scratches. Adobe Lightroom, Photoshop, or free alternatives like GIMP or Darktable are excellent choices.
Setting Up Your Film Scanning Station
- Assemble Your Light Source and Film Holder: Position your light source on a stable surface and place your film holder on top. Ensure the light is evenly distributed across the film area.
- Mount Your Camera and Lens: Attach your macro lens to your Canon Rebel XS and mount the camera on your copy stand or tripod. Position the camera directly above the film holder, ensuring the lens is perpendicular to the film.
- Connect to Tethering Software (Optional): If using tethering software, connect your camera to your computer via USB and launch the software.
- Focus and Compose: Use live view on your camera (or the tethering software) to zoom in and focus precisely on the film grain. Adjust the camera position to ensure the entire frame is filled with the image area of the film.
- Set Your Exposure: Use manual mode (M) on your camera. Set the aperture to around f/8 or f/11 for optimal sharpness and depth of field. Adjust the ISO to the lowest possible setting (usually 100) to minimize noise. Use the shutter speed to fine-tune the exposure until the histogram shows a balanced distribution.
- Capture and Repeat: Take a test shot and review it carefully. Adjust the exposure or focus as needed. Once you’re satisfied, capture the remaining frames of your roll of film.
Post-Processing: Bringing Your Film to Life
The raw images from your camera will require post-processing to achieve the desired results. Here’s a general workflow:
- Import and Organize: Import your images into your chosen scanning and editing software.
- Invert Negatives (If Necessary): If scanning negatives, you’ll need to invert them to positive images. Most software offers a dedicated negative inversion tool.
- Crop and Rotate: Crop the images to remove any borders or extraneous areas. Rotate the images if necessary to ensure they’re properly oriented.
- Adjust Exposure and Contrast: Fine-tune the exposure and contrast to achieve a balanced and pleasing image.
- Color Correction: Adjust the white balance and color tones to accurately represent the colors in the original film.
- Dust and Scratch Removal: Use the software’s tools to remove any dust, scratches, or other imperfections from the images.
- Sharpen: Apply a subtle amount of sharpening to enhance the details of the image.
- Save: Save your final images in a suitable format, such as JPEG or TIFF.

H3: What is the best macro lens for scanning film with the Rebel XS?
A dedicated macro lens with a 1:1 magnification ratio is crucial. The Canon EF 50mm f/2.5 Compact Macro, the EF 100mm f/2.8 Macro USM, or third-party options from Sigma, Tamron, or Laowa are all excellent choices. The choice depends on your budget and preferred working distance.
H3: What settings should I use on my Canon Rebel XS for film scanning?
Use manual mode (M). Set your ISO to the lowest possible setting (usually 100). Choose an aperture between f/8 and f/11 for optimal sharpness. Adjust the shutter speed to achieve proper exposure, using the histogram as a guide.
H3: How do I get sharp focus when scanning film?
Use live view with maximum zoom to focus on the film grain. A focusing rail can help with fine-tuning the focus. Ensure your setup is stable to avoid camera shake.
H3: What is the best light source for film scanning?
A daylight-balanced LED light panel provides a consistent and diffused light source. Avoid direct sunlight. A light box can also work well.
H3: How do I prevent Newton’s rings when scanning film?
Newton’s rings are interference patterns caused by close contact between the film and a glass surface. To avoid them, use a film holder that keeps the film slightly separated from the glass or use anti-Newton glass.
H3: What software should I use for inverting negatives?
Adobe Photoshop, Lightroom, Negative Lab Pro (a plugin for Lightroom), or free alternatives like GIMP or Darktable all offer tools for inverting negatives.
H3: How do I remove dust and scratches from my film scans?
Use the clone stamp tool or healing brush in Photoshop or similar software. Some dedicated film scanning software also has built-in dust and scratch removal features.
H3: How can I improve the color accuracy of my film scans?
Use a color checker chart and calibrate your editing software. Pay attention to the white balance and color tones during post-processing.
H3: What resolution should I scan my film at?
A resolution of 2400-4000 DPI is generally sufficient for most purposes. Higher resolutions will capture more detail but will also result in larger file sizes.
H3: Can I scan slides with the same setup?
Yes, the same setup can be used for scanning slides. You’ll need a slide holder instead of a negative holder.
H3: Is DSLR scanning better than using a dedicated film scanner?
It depends. Dedicated film scanners often offer higher resolution and dynamic range. However, DSLR scanning can be faster, more affordable, and produce excellent results with the right equipment and techniques.
H3: How do I avoid camera shake when scanning film?
Use a sturdy tripod or copy stand. Use a remote shutter release or the camera’s self-timer to trigger the shutter without touching the camera. Mirror lock-up (if available on your camera) can also help.
